About this property

Ty Canol 5

As soon as you start driving down the private mountain road to Nant Gwrtheyrn you’re met with the most spectacular views of heather sweeping down to the sea. Nestled between the ruins of a once bustling granite quarry is Tŷ Canol, once an old barn now converted into 4 self catering accommodation awaiting guests that long for the peace and tranquillity of this hidden gem on the Llŷn Peninsula.
Tŷ Canol offers an open plan kitchenette with fridge, microwave and single induction ring and a lounge with sofa bed with mountain views dotted with old mine and past agricultural ruins. The downstairs also provides a shower room. Walking up stairs you are welcomed by a king size bed and Velux window.
The floors and furniture are made of solid oak by Welsh craftsmen. There is a traditional Welsh blanket specially designed for Nant Gwrtheyrn by Melin Tregwynt on each bed. Free WIFI is also available in Tŷ Canol and the onsite café offers a varied selection of drinks, snacks and cakes.
Nant Gwrtheyrn is the home of the National Welsh language and heritage centre and the Wales Coast path meanders down to the beach past the free car parking spaces for guests. No street lights provides the perfect opportunity to admire the night skies of this remote, inspiring location. The silence from no television is golden.

Great quiet location with a lot of history
Accommodation and location were near perfect if you want to be away from it all. However, just a couple of items to note that may help. Although it does sleep 4, there is limited space for 4, especially for eating, apart from a small table where you have to sit on the floor. There is nowhere to buy food after the cafe is closed at 5.00. Lastly, the one thing I was very disappointed about was the so-called Dark area. Both nights were illuminated with various lights from cafe, and there were lots of them, and other houses, to make it look like Blackpool illuminations; so not dark at all!
